Air Fryer Honey Garlic Salmon

Ingredients

  • 4 salmon fillets
  • 1/4 cup honey
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on ginger, grated
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on green onions, chopped (for garnish)

Prep Time, Cook Time, Total Time, Yield

Prep Time: 30 minutes (plus marinating time)

Cook Time: 12 minutes

Total Time: 42 minutes (plus marinating time)

Yield: 4 servings

Directions and Instructions

  1. In a medium bowl, whisk together the honey, soy sauce, minced garlic, olive oil, grated ginger, and black pepper until well combined. This sweet and aromatic marinade is the heart of the dish!
  2. Place the salmon fillets in a shallow dish and pour the marinade over them, ensuring each fillet is nicely coated. For maximum flavor, let the salmon marinate for at least 30 minutes, or up to 2 hours in the refrigerator.
  3. Preheat your air fryer to 400°F (200°C) while the salmon marinates, filling your kitchen with an enticing aroma.
  4. Carefully remove the salmon from the marinade, allowing any excess liquid to drip off. Don’t toss the marinade just yet; reserve it for later!
  5. Arrange the salmon fillets in the air fryer basket, making sure they are not overlapping to ensure even cooking.
  6. Air fry the salmon for 10-12 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 145°F (63°C) and the fish flakes easily with a fork. You’ll love watching the salmon transform into a gorgeous golden brown creation!
  7. While the salmon cooks, pour the reserved marinade into a small saucepan and bring it to a boil. Reduce the heat and let it simmer for 2-3 minutes until it thickens slightly, creating a lovely glaze.
  8. Once your salmon is perfect, remove it from the air fryer and drizzle the thickened marinade over the top for that extra burst of flavor.
  9. Garnish with chopped green onions before serving to add a pop of color and freshness!

Notes or Tips

For a delightful twist, try adding a sprinkle of sesame seeds on top before serving. The crunch adds a fantastic texture that complements the dish beautifully! Also, feel free to experiment with other herbs or spices in the marinade like cayenne pepper for a kick or fresh herbs for a brighter taste.

FAQ

Can I use frozen salmon? Yes, you can! Just make sure to thaw the salmon completely before marinating for the best flavor and texture.

How do I know when the salmon is done? The salmon is ready when it flakes easily with a fork and reaches an internal temperature of 145°F (63°C).

What can I serve with this salmon? This dish pairs wonderfully with steamed rice, roasted vegetables, or a fresh salad—perfect for a well-rounded meal!
